Pet s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a pet sitter in New Cumberland on Rover as of Mar 2026 was about $20 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A pet s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your pet’s needs.
As of Mar 2026, there are 270 pet sitters in New Cumberland.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ect pet sitter near you. As a reminder, pet s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your pet’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ple pet sitters about your booking. Typically, 84% of New Cumberland pet sitters respond in under an hour.
Pet sitters in New Cumberland have an average of 11 years of experience. Pet sitters with repeat customers have an average of 7 repeat clients. Experience can vary from pet sitter to pet s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are pet sitters in New Cumberland.

In New Cumberland, 100% of pet sitters offer daily exercise, 93% offer medication administration, and 93% have experience with senior pets and pets with special needs.
